Output 3bd521b8c587c796b08ddfc8bd72696123ea8052b90dc28d3e9ee8a654dabea1:1

value
1887543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512e40e3d38d737e79158c56c1759e33e234660e OP_EQUALVERIFY OP_CHECKSIG
address
18QF9HbaicXhGdEKxpbEG5UEHbpn7r693D
transaction
3bd521b8c587c796b08ddfc8bd72696123ea8052b90dc28d3e9ee8a654dabea1
spent
true